Product Overview
4-Bromobenzyl alcohol is a versatile brominated aromatic alcohol with important roles in pharmaceuticals, agrochemicals and advanced materials.
In Pharmaceuticals, 4-Bromobenzyl alcohol is used to synthesize brominated benzyl derivatives with bio-activity and is an important ingredient in anti-microbial and anti-fungal agents. It is also a CNS drug precursor, making it crucial for drugs which target neurological disorders. Moreover, it can be modified to form ester prodrugs for improved bioavailability.
Its dual functionality (–OH and –Br) makes it valuable for cross-coupling reactions, Grignard chemistry and chiral synthesis. Specifically, the –OH group can be used to protect amines or carboxylic acids in peptide chemistry. The bromo group enables Pd-catalyzed cross-coupling with boronic acids in Suzuki-Miyaura Coupling.

4-Bromobenzyl alcohol is also the building block for brominated phenyl-based agrochemicals.
In material science, 4-Bromobenzyl is used in synthesizing brominated aromatic cores for optoelectronic materials, making it useful in producing OLED.
